Job Description

Overview:Quinnipiac University invites applications for Part-Time Faculty Anthropology.  The Department of Sociology and Anthropology in the College of Arts and Sciences seeks highly qualified applicants who are committed to excellence in teaching for part-time faculty positions for Spring 2026. We are particularly interested in individuals with experience teaching Forensic Anthropology to undergraduates, in-person. Course sections during the day and evening are available.

About the School/Program:

The breadth of programs offered in the College of Arts and Sciences provides the traditional strengths of a liberal arts education, with a focus on cultivating the intellectual and practical skills that students need for their personal and professional lives. The College of Arts and Sciences offers undergraduate majors in behavioral neuroscience, biochemistry, biology, chemistry, criminal justice, economics, English, game design and development, gerontology, history, independent majors, interdisciplinary studies, law in society, mathematics, philosophy, political science, psychology, sociology, Spanish language and literature, and theater.

In addition, the College of Arts and Sciences offers 31 undergraduate minors (including a minor in Italian), a MS in Molecular and Cell Biology and the additional accelerated undergraduate/graduate programs: 3+1 and 4+1 BS/MS programs in Molecular and Cell Biology, 3+3 BA or BS/JD degree, 3+1 BA in Theater/MBA, and 3+2 BA or BS/MSW. Students can also complete a 5-year BA/BS and MA in Teaching in the following secondary education fields: Biology, English, History, Math, and Spanish.

About Quinnipiac:Quinnipiac is a private, coeducational, institution located 90 minutes north of New York City and two hours from Boston. The university enrolls 9,000 students in more than 130 degree programs through its Schools of Business, Communications, Education, Computing and Engineering, Health Sciences, Law, Medicine, Nursing and the College of Arts and Sciences. Responsibilities:

  • Implementing a common course syllabus, or developing and/or updating a course syllabus, as applicable. Posting the syllabus to Canvas.
  • Preparing lectures, projects, or other student assignments.
  • Presenting instruction based on the competencies and performance levels of the course.
  • Meeting all scheduled classes at the times published in the course schedule.
  • Being responsive to student needs, including holding at least one office hour per week per course.
  • Notifying your department chair or program director in advance and arranging for coverage, in the unusual event that you cannot be present at a scheduled class.
  • Checking Quinnipiac email frequently to stay current with all communications.
  • Completing mandatory training within the time frame identified as defined by Human Resources. Examples include: Harassment & Discrimination, Data Security & Privacy and Managing Bias.

Education Requirements:

  • A minimum of an MA degree in Anthropology or a related field is required; PhD preferred.

Qualifications:

  • Relevant teaching experience at the undergraduate level is preferred.
  • Evidence of recent effective teaching.
  • Experience in the use of instructional technologies, especially Blackboard or Canvas.
  • Proven ability to collaborate effectively with individuals from varied backgrounds
